Convention centre developer looking for public feedback

The province has announced that developer Joe Ramia will be accepting public feedback on the design of the new convention centre.

Infrastructure Renewal Minister Bill Estabrooks said Thursday that public consultation was part of the requirements for the winning contract.

He tells Metro Ramia is free to decide how he’ll gather input but open houses, a website and toll-free phone number are all possibilities.

Estabrooks says he expects Ramia to take the public feedback seriously, but says it’s the developer who has the final say on the design.
